Difference between revisions of "Function Index"

From Archaic Pixels
Jump to: navigation, search
 
Line 1: Line 1:
 
{{:Styled Table}}
 
{{:Styled Table}}
 
<css>
 
<css>
 +
.styled_table_min
 +
{
 +
  width: 700px;
 +
}
 
.styled_table_min td
 
.styled_table_min td
 
{
 
{
Line 12: Line 16:
 
! By Section !! By Name
 
! By Section !! By Name
 
|-
 
|-
|
+
|  
 
* [[Video Functions]]
 
* [[Video Functions]]
 
** [[Video Functions#disp_off | disp_off]]
 
** [[Video Functions#disp_off | disp_off]]
Line 25: Line 29:
 
** [[Video Functions#load_background | load_background]]
 
** [[Video Functions#load_background | load_background]]
 
** [[Video Functions#set_xres | set_xres]]
 
** [[Video Functions#set_xres | set_xres]]
 
 
* [[Palette Functions]]
 
* [[Palette Functions]]
 
** [[Palette Functions#set_color | set_color]]
 
** [[Palette Functions#set_color | set_color]]
Line 33: Line 36:
 
** [[Palette Functions#set_sprpal | set_sprpal]]
 
** [[Palette Functions#set_sprpal | set_sprpal]]
 
** [[Palette Functions#set_bgpal | set_bgpal]]
 
** [[Palette Functions#set_bgpal | set_bgpal]]
 
 
* [[Font Functions]]
 
* [[Font Functions]]
 
** [[Font Functions#set_font_color | set_font_color]]
 
** [[Font Functions#set_font_color | set_font_color]]
Line 42: Line 44:
 
** [[Font Functions#load_default_font | load_default_font]]
 
** [[Font Functions#load_default_font | load_default_font]]
 
** [[Font Functions#load_font | load_font]]
 
** [[Font Functions#load_font | load_font]]
 
 
* [[Text Output Functions]]
 
* [[Text Output Functions]]
 
** [[Text Output Functions#put_digit | put_digit]]
 
** [[Text Output Functions#put_digit | put_digit]]
Line 50: Line 51:
 
** [[Text Output Functions#put_hex | put_hex]]
 
** [[Text Output Functions#put_hex | put_hex]]
 
** [[Text Output Functions#put_string | put_string]]
 
** [[Text Output Functions#put_string | put_string]]
 
 
* [[String Functions]]
 
* [[String Functions]]
 
** [[String Functions#strcpy / strncpy / memcpy | strcpy / strncpy / memcpy]]
 
** [[String Functions#strcpy / strncpy / memcpy | strcpy / strncpy / memcpy]]
 
** [[String Functions#strcat / strncat | strcat / strncat]]
 
** [[String Functions#strcat / strncat | strcat / strncat]]
 
** [[String Functions#strcmp / strncmp / memcmp | strcmp / strncmp / memcmp]]
 
** [[String Functions#strcmp / strncmp / memcmp | strcmp / strncmp / memcmp]]
 
 
* [[Tile and Map Functions]]
 
* [[Tile and Map Functions]]
 
** [[Tile and Map Functions#set_tile_data | set_tile_data]]
 
** [[Tile and Map Functions#set_tile_data | set_tile_data]]
Line 67: Line 66:
 
** [[Tile and Map Functions#scroll | scroll]]
 
** [[Tile and Map Functions#scroll | scroll]]
 
** [[Tile and Map Functions#scroll_disable | scroll_disable]]
 
** [[Tile and Map Functions#scroll_disable | scroll_disable]]
 
 
* [[Pixel Graphics Functions]]
 
* [[Pixel Graphics Functions]]
 
** [[Pixel Graphics Functions#gfx_setbgpal | gfx_setbgpal]]
 
** [[Pixel Graphics Functions#gfx_setbgpal | gfx_setbgpal]]
Line 75: Line 73:
 
** [[Pixel Graphics Functions#gfx_point | gfx_point]]
 
** [[Pixel Graphics Functions#gfx_point | gfx_point]]
 
** [[Pixel Graphics Functions#gfx_line | gfx_line]]
 
** [[Pixel Graphics Functions#gfx_line | gfx_line]]
 
 
* [[Sprite Functions]]
 
* [[Sprite Functions]]
 
** [[Sprite Functions#load_sprites | load_sprites]]
 
** [[Sprite Functions#load_sprites | load_sprites]]
Line 94: Line 91:
 
** [[Sprite Functions#spr_hide | spr_hide]]
 
** [[Sprite Functions#spr_hide | spr_hide]]
 
** [[Sprite Functions#spr_show | spr_show]]
 
** [[Sprite Functions#spr_show | spr_show]]
 
 
* [[Gamepad Functions]]
 
* [[Gamepad Functions]]
 
** [[Gamepad Functions#joy | joy]]
 
** [[Gamepad Functions#joy | joy]]
Line 101: Line 97:
 
** [[Gamepad Functions#get_joy_events | get_joy_events]]
 
** [[Gamepad Functions#get_joy_events | get_joy_events]]
 
** [[Gamepad Functions#clear_joy_events | clear_joy_events]]
 
** [[Gamepad Functions#clear_joy_events | clear_joy_events]]
 
 
* [[Mouse Functions]]
 
* [[Mouse Functions]]
 
** [[Mouse Functions#mouse_exists | mouse_exists]]
 
** [[Mouse Functions#mouse_exists | mouse_exists]]
Line 108: Line 103:
 
** [[Mouse Functions#mouse_x | mouse_x]]
 
** [[Mouse Functions#mouse_x | mouse_x]]
 
** [[Mouse Functions#mouse_y | mouse_y]]
 
** [[Mouse Functions#mouse_y | mouse_y]]
 
 
* [[Backup RAM Functions]]
 
* [[Backup RAM Functions]]
 
** [[Backup RAM Functions#bm_check | bm_check]]
 
** [[Backup RAM Functions#bm_check | bm_check]]
Line 129: Line 123:
 
** [[Backup RAM Functions#bm_checksum | bm_checksum]]
 
** [[Backup RAM Functions#bm_checksum | bm_checksum]]
 
** [[Backup RAM Functions#bm_setup_ptr | bm_setup_ptr]]
 
** [[Backup RAM Functions#bm_setup_ptr | bm_setup_ptr]]
 
 
* [[CDROM Functions]]
 
* [[CDROM Functions]]
 
** [[CDROM Functions#cd_reset | cd_reset]]
 
** [[CDROM Functions#cd_reset | cd_reset]]
Line 144: Line 137:
 
** [[CDROM Functions#cd_loadvram | cd_loadvram]]
 
** [[CDROM Functions#cd_loadvram | cd_loadvram]]
 
** [[CDROM Functions#cd_execoverlay | cd_execoverlay]]
 
** [[CDROM Functions#cd_execoverlay | cd_execoverlay]]
 
 
* [[ADPCM Functions]]
 
* [[ADPCM Functions]]
 
** [[ADPCM Functions#ad_reset | ad_reset]]
 
** [[ADPCM Functions#ad_reset | ad_reset]]
Line 153: Line 145:
 
** [[ADPCM Functions#ad_write | ad_write]]
 
** [[ADPCM Functions#ad_write | ad_write]]
 
** [[ADPCM Functions#ad_play | ad_play]]
 
** [[ADPCM Functions#ad_play | ad_play]]
 
 
* [[Arcade Card Functions]]
 
* [[Arcade Card Functions]]
 
** [[Arcade Card Functions#ac_exists | ac_exists]]
 
** [[Arcade Card Functions#ac_exists | ac_exists]]
 
 
* [[Misc Functions]]
 
* [[Misc Functions]]
 
** [[Misc Functions#clock_reset | clock_reset]]
 
** [[Misc Functions#clock_reset | clock_reset]]
Line 165: Line 155:
 
** [[Misc Functions#rand | rand]]
 
** [[Misc Functions#rand | rand]]
 
** [[Misc Functions#srand / srand32 | srand / srand32]]
 
** [[Misc Functions#srand / srand32 | srand / srand32]]
** [[Misc Functions#random | random | random | random]]
+
** [[Misc Functions#random | random]]
|
+
|  
 
* [[Arcade Card Functions#ac_exists | ac_exists]]
 
* [[Arcade Card Functions#ac_exists | ac_exists]]
 
* [[ADPCM Functions#ad_play | ad_play]]
 
* [[ADPCM Functions#ad_play | ad_play]]
Line 214: Line 204:
 
* [[Video Functions#disp_on | disp_on]]
 
* [[Video Functions#disp_on | disp_on]]
 
* [[Misc Functions#farmemget | farmemget]]
 
* [[Misc Functions#farmemget | farmemget]]
 +
* [[Misc Functions#peek / peekw / farpeekb / farpeekw | farpeekb / farpeekw]]
 
* [[Palette Functions#get_color | get_color]]
 
* [[Palette Functions#get_color | get_color]]
 
* [[Font Functions#get_font_addr | get_font_addr]]
 
* [[Font Functions#get_font_addr | get_font_addr]]
Line 239: Line 230:
 
* [[Tile and Map Functions#map_get_tile | map_get_tile]]
 
* [[Tile and Map Functions#map_get_tile | map_get_tile]]
 
* [[Tile and Map Functions#map_put_tile | map_put_tile]]
 
* [[Tile and Map Functions#map_put_tile | map_put_tile]]
 +
* [[String Functions#strcmp / strncmp / memcmp | memcmp]]
 +
* [[String Functions#strcpy / strncpy / memcpy | memcpy]]
 
* [[Mouse Functions#mouse_disable | mouse_disable]]
 
* [[Mouse Functions#mouse_disable | mouse_disable]]
 
* [[Mouse Functions#mouse_enable | mouse_enable]]
 
* [[Mouse Functions#mouse_enable | mouse_enable]]
Line 244: Line 237:
 
* [[Mouse Functions#mouse_x | mouse_x]]
 
* [[Mouse Functions#mouse_x | mouse_x]]
 
* [[Mouse Functions#mouse_y | mouse_y]]
 
* [[Mouse Functions#mouse_y | mouse_y]]
* [[Misc Functions#peek / peekw / farpeekb / farpeekw | peek / peekw / farpeekb / farpeekw]]
+
* [[Misc Functions#peek / peekw / farpeekb / farpeekw | peek / peekw]]
 
* [[Misc Functions#poke / pokew | poke / pokew]]
 
* [[Misc Functions#poke / pokew | poke / pokew]]
 
* [[Text Output Functions#put_char | put_char]]
 
* [[Text Output Functions#put_char | put_char]]
Line 286: Line 279:
 
* [[Misc Functions#srand / srand32 | srand / srand32]]
 
* [[Misc Functions#srand / srand32 | srand / srand32]]
 
* [[String Functions#strcat / strncat | strcat / strncat]]
 
* [[String Functions#strcat / strncat | strcat / strncat]]
* [[String Functions#strcmp / strncmp / memcmp | strcmp / strncmp / memcmp]]
+
* [[String Functions#strcmp / strncmp / memcmp | strcmp / strncmp]]
* [[String Functions#strcpy / strncpy / memcpy | strcpy / strncpy / memcpy]]
+
* [[String Functions#strcpy / strncpy / memcpy | strcpy / strncpy]]
 
* [[Video Functions#vram_addr | vram_addr]]
 
* [[Video Functions#vram_addr | vram_addr]]
 
* [[Video Functions#vreg | vreg]]
 
* [[Video Functions#vreg | vreg]]
 
* [[Video Functions#vsync | vsync]]
 
* [[Video Functions#vsync | vsync]]
 
|}
 
|}

Latest revision as of 07:06, 16 September 2010


By Section By Name